The amount of water recommended by the United Nations for drinking, washing, cooking and maintaining proper hygiene is a minimum of .............per person per day. This amount is about ................buckets of water per person per day.
A)50 litres, two and a half
B)25 litres, two and a half
C)50 litres, one and a half
D)75 litres, three and a half

The amount of water recommended by the US per person in a day is around 50 litres. This is equivalent to two and a half buckets of water.( Standard bucket size is around 20 litres).

In the US the FDA and Environment Protection Agency(EPA) is responsible for regulation of safety in drinking water. The tap water is checked by EPA whereas the FDA is responsible for packaged drinking water.

Hence, the correct answer is option (A)
